Xenoblade Chronicles 2 for the Nintendo Switch is available in multiple formats, including standard game cartridges, digital downloads from the Nintendo eShop, and a comprehensive Expansion Pass. Digital and Physical Versions
Base Game: The primary experience follows Rex and Pyra. It is approximately 13GB in size. Torna – The Golden Country
: This is a major story expansion that serves as a prequel. It was released digitally for Expansion Pass holders on September 14, 2018, and as a standalone physical cartridge on September 21, 2018. The physical standalone version includes a download code for the main game's Expansion Pass content.
Expansion Pass: For approximately $30, this includes all DLC content: helpful items, new quests, a "New Rare Blade Pack," a "Challenge Battle Mode," and the full Torna – The Golden Country expansion. File Formats and Sizes
NSP/XCI: These are common file extensions for digital (NSP) and physical cartridge dumps (XCI) used for archival or emulation purposes. Tools exist to combine base games with their updates and DLC into single files for easier use. File Sizes : Main Game: ~13 GB. Torna – The Golden Country : ~3.2 GB to 3.3 GB. Game Overview and Core Mechanics
Set in the world of Alrest, where civilizations live on the backs of colossal creatures known as Titans, you follow the story of Rex and his companion Pyra, a powerful living weapon called a Blade.
Blade Bonding System: Central to the game is the relationship between Drivers (humans) and Blades (weaponized lifeforms). Players use Core Crystals to "awaken" new Blades, each with unique elements, weapons, and roles like Attacker, Healer, or Tank.
Deep Combat: Combat is a layered auto-attack system where players manage "Arts" and "Blade Combos" to unleash devastating elemental attacks. The system is highly strategic, requiring players to switch between three active Blades during battle to maximize efficiency.

experience on Nintendo Switch, understanding the relationship between the base game, file formats, and the Expansion Pass content is essential. Core Game Formats: NSP vs. XCI
When dealing with digital backups or regional versions, you will typically encounter two primary file formats:
XCI (Cartridge Image): A direct digital dump of a physical game cartridge. Standard XCI files usually contain only the base game as it existed on the physical disc at launch.
NSP (Nintendo Submission Package): The standard format for games downloaded from the eShop, as well as all digital updates and DLC.
The "Full" Package: While some "Custom XCIs" exist that bundle the base game, updates, and DLC into a single large file, it is more common to have a base file (either XCI or NSP) and then install separate NSP files for the updates and DLC. Essential Updates
The most recent version of Xenoblade Chronicles 2 is Ver. 2.1.0 (Released September 2020). Key milestones in the update history include: Ver. 2.1.0: Added Korean text support.
Ver. 1.3.0: Introduced New Game Plus (Advanced New Game) and "Easy" difficulty.
Ver. 2.0.2: Fixed specific Blade issues and added the "Massive Melee Mythra" outfit. Expansion Pass & DLC Content

An NSP file is a package ripped from Nintendo’s CDN (Content Delivery Network). These are the digital versions sold on the eShop. NSP files are more common for DLC and updates because Nintendo distributes patches digitally. A “base” NSP for XC2 is roughly the same size as an XCI, but NSPs are easier to install layered updates over.
Q: Can I use an XCI base with an NSP update? A: Yes. Modern installers (Tinfoil, DBI) treat XCI and NSP identically for updates.
Q: My game says “Ver. 1.5.0” even after installing v2.1.0. Why? A: You probably installed the update to the wrong location. Delete the update from system settings and reinstall over USB.
Q: Is Torna included in the DLC? Or is it a separate game?
A: The DLC version of Torna is accessed from the main XC2 title screen. A standalone Torna cartridge exists (Title ID 0100C9D00E6F8000), but that is a separate game. For a “full” XC2, you want the DLC version.
